Overview

The TDA7052 is a 1W mono Bridge-Tied Load (BTL) audio power amplifier IC manufactured by NXP Semiconductors (originally Philips). Designed specifically for battery-operated portable equipment (such as handheld radios, walkie-talkies, small battery speakers, and microcontroller voice prompts), it operates over a supply range of 3.0V to 18.0V DC.

Utilizing a Bridge-Tied Load (BTL) output architecture, the speaker is connected differentially between two internal output amplifiers (OUT1 and OUT2). This quadruples the output power compared to a single-ended amplifier at the same supply voltage and eliminates the large output DC-blocking capacitor, dramatically reducing PCB component count and physical size.

Common mistakes

  • Connecting BTL speaker outputs (OUT1 or OUT2) to Ground: Because the speaker is driven differentially across OUT1 and OUT2 (both resting at VP/2V_P / 2), grounding either terminal creates an immediate DC short-circuit that damages the IC.
  • Connecting a headphone jack with shared ground: Headphone jacks share a common ground terminal between left and right channels. BTL outputs cannot drive shared-ground headphones directly.

Notes

  • TDA7052 vs TDA7052A: TDA7052 has a fixed 39 dB39\text{ dB} gain; TDA7052A includes an internal DC-voltage controlled volume control circuit on Pin 4 (0V1.4V0\text{V} \dots 1.4\text{V} volume adjustment).
